Back in 1418, Prince Henry from Portugal had started the very first school for navigation of the sea with something called astronomical observatory. The students were trained and taught in navigation, science, and map making.

In the past, Prince Henry was incredibly determined to find a way to navigate Cape Bojador. In fact, he was so determined to find a way, that he had sponsored fourteen expeditions over a period of twelve years. Unfortunately, he did not find a way and this lead to the success of Gil Eannes, an explorer. He successfully mapped his voyage for the exporters in the future.
